0 reports about 3782305825The number was first reported 31st Jul, 2025
Received a phone call from 3782305825? Report here
File a report about 3782305825 |
Phone Number Variations: 3782305825, 03782-305825, 913782305825, 003782305825, 1913782305825, +1913782305825